Output 9421a63f94945938e5833918de9507ca0e6ff9dad064dc293ce7499765f7d5c0:1

value
28436084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f8ea3180437055b533bfbc50e897f90a2e7d9d OP_EQUAL
address
MBBN53o5Dzq2RpMBXEqgkwX1CnUrJehAQ6
transaction
9421a63f94945938e5833918de9507ca0e6ff9dad064dc293ce7499765f7d5c0
spent
true